[ https://issues.apache.org/jira/browse/MESOS-6781?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]
Anand Mazumdar updated MESOS-6781: ---------------------------------- Target Version/s: 1.2.0 > Mesos containerizer overrides environment variables passed to the executor > incorrectly. > --------------------------------------------------------------------------------------- > > Key: MESOS-6781 > URL: https://issues.apache.org/jira/browse/MESOS-6781 > Project: Mesos > Issue Type: Bug > Components: containerization > Reporter: Anand Mazumdar > Assignee: Jie Yu > Priority: Blocker > Labels: mesosphere > > Currently, the mesos containerizer appends the default environment variables > of the executor and appends them _after_ any environment that were > over-ridden by an isolator. This is problematic e.g., if the CNI isolator > over-rides {{LIBPROCESS_IP}} in an overlay network. The containerizer would > give the executor environment variables more preference meaning that the > container would end up inheriting the IP address of the agent! > https://github.com/apache/mesos/blob/master/src/slave/containerizer/mesos/containerizer.cpp#L1412-L1421 -- This message was sent by Atlassian JIRA (v6.3.4#6332)